Output f31244b71bb5b4cc70829ec609def7934b8fdc72d2c6bac28b0b261ccf881563:65

value
269436
script pubkey
OP_0 OP_PUSHBYTES_20 e5b93843fb3521ad2a501266afbb9ed5037f63be
address
bc1qukunsslmx5s662jszfn2lwu765ph7ca7wldvcx
transaction
f31244b71bb5b4cc70829ec609def7934b8fdc72d2c6bac28b0b261ccf881563
confirmations
19531
spent
true